TAP-NY Deal Alert: MOCATalks with author Abigail Hing Wen: Loveboat, Taipei

Loveboat Taipei

Join the Museum of Chinese in America (MOCA) to meet and talk with author Abigail Hing Wen about her debut novel Loveboat, Taipei. It is a young adult Crazy Rich Asians, inspired by the actual cultural exchange program in Taipei attended by many Asian American teens since the 1960s. The romp is woven through with an immigrant girl’s coming-of-age story, of navigating family complexities, discovering identity in all its facets, and finding love. PVP Letter 2020: What We’re Excited About

TAP-NY at Ski Trip

Dear TAP-NY Family, Happy New Year! As we enter 2020, we want to first thank you for your support and engagement over the last decade. In 2010, we officially became a chapter of our parent organization, Taiwanese American Citizens League (TACL), and hosted our first TAPpy Hour and Olympics. With your help, we have grown tremendously to become one of the largest Asian-interest community groups in the greater NYC area, with over 6,500 members and 100 plus events a year.
